" We are delighted to offer this unique THREE bedroom first floor maisonette with its own PRIVATE GARDEN. Internally the accommodation comprises private entrance hall, ground floor study, fitted kitchen, living/dining room two double bedrooms, one single bedroom, family bathroom and separate WC. Double glazed throughout. To the outside there is a 40ft private garden to the rear, garage and parking. The property is ideal for an investment landlord, first time buyer or downsizer and is conveniently located for Lower Ashtead and the M25 at Junction 9 with easy access to Gatwick and Heathrow airports.

Entrance
Double glazed front door leading to:

Ground Floor Study
Storage cupboard housing utility meters, radiator and stairs leading to first floor.

Hallway
Wood laminate floor, storage cupboard and hatch to loft. Doors leading off to:

Cloakroom
Quarry tiled floor, part tiled walls, low level WC and corner wash basin, radiator. Obscure double glazed window to side aspect

Bedroom One 12'2 x 11'6 ft (3.71m x 3.51m m)
Fitted double wardrobes with glass sliding doors, radiator, ceiling downlights. Double glazed windows to front and side aspect.

Bedroom Two 11'10 x 8'0 ft (3.61m x 2.44m m)
Wood laminate floor, radiator, ceiling downlights. Double glazed window to side aspect.

Bedroom Three 7'11 x 6'3 ft (2.41m x 1.91m m)
Wood laminate floor, radiator, ceiling downlights. Double glazed window to front aspect.

Bathroom
Fully tiled walls, tiled floor, pedestal wash basin, corner bath with central mixer taps and shower attachment, shower and bifold glass shower screen. Heated towel rail, ceiling downlights. Obscure double glazed window to side aspect.

Lounge/Dining Room 15'10 x 11'6 ft (4.83m x 3.51m m)
Double doors opening into wood laminate floor, coal effect gas fire with wooden mantel and stone hearth. Radiator, TV aerial socket, ornate ceiling and coving, orginal dado rail. Double glazed windows to side and rear aspect.

Kitchen 11'2 x 8'5 ft (3.4m x 2.57m m)
Archway into ceramic tiled floor, range of white wall, base and drawer units, stainless steel sink and drainer with tiled splashback. Wall mounted Glo Worm boiler. Integrated Whirlpool four ring gas hob with Whirlpool extractor over and Whirlpool double oven. Space and plumbing for washing machine and dishwasher and space for under counter fridge freezer. Timber clad ceiling with downlights. Double glazed window to side and rear aspect.

Outside
To the front of the property there is off street parking and a small garden area with mature schrubs. To the rear of the property there is a Garage and a private 40ft garden which is mainly laid to lawn and a paved patio area, Pergoda and lighting.
